Out again by 9 a/m/!!!  Off to see Civil War and Locomotive Museum in Kennesaw.    Very interesting. In 1862, 22 northern soldiers, dressed as civilians, came south to steal a train engine, led by Andrews.  Under the nose of the conductor of THE GENERAL ,   the soldiers unhooked the engine and took off stopping at a RR camp stealing tools to disable the tracks for anyone chasing them.  The conductor, William Fuller, led townsmen to capture the engine back.  The soldiers dropped RR ties on the tracks to slow Fuller down.  The whole time, Fuller was running another engine in reverse to catch the theives!!   All failed and the General was recovered by Fuller.  The great locomotive chase!!
